- /* $Id: pgalloc.h,v 1.30 2001/12/21 04:56:17 davem Exp $ */
- #ifndef _SPARC64_PGALLOC_H
- #define _SPARC64_PGALLOC_H
- #include <linux/config.h>
- #include <linux/kernel.h>
- #include <linux/sched.h>
- #include <linux/mm.h>
- #include <linux/slab.h>
- #include <asm/spitfire.h>
- #include <asm/cpudata.h>
- #include <asm/cacheflush.h>
- #include <asm/page.h>
- /* Page table allocation/freeing. */
- extern kmem_cache_t *pgtable_cache;
- static inline pgd_t *pgd_alloc(struct mm_struct *mm)
- {
- return kmem_cache_alloc(pgtable_cache, GFP_KERNEL);
- }
- static inline void pgd_free(pgd_t *pgd)
- {
- kmem_cache_free(pgtable_cache, pgd);
- }
- #define pud_populate(MM, PUD, PMD) pud_set(PUD, PMD)
- static inline pmd_t *pmd_alloc_one(struct mm_struct *mm, unsigned long addr)
- {
- return kmem_cache_alloc(pgtable_cache,
- GFP_KERNEL|__GFP_REPEAT);
- }
- static inline void pmd_free(pmd_t *pmd)
- {
- kmem_cache_free(pgtable_cache, pmd);
- }
- static inline pte_t *pte_alloc_one_kernel(struct mm_struct *mm,
- unsigned long address)
- {
- return kmem_cache_alloc(pgtable_cache,
- GFP_KERNEL|__GFP_REPEAT);
- }
- static inline struct page *pte_alloc_one(struct mm_struct *mm,
- unsigned long address)
- {
- return virt_to_page(pte_alloc_one_kernel(mm, address));
- }
-
- static inline void pte_free_kernel(pte_t *pte)
- {
- kmem_cache_free(pgtable_cache, pte);
- }
- static inline void pte_free(struct page *ptepage)
- {
- pte_free_kernel(page_address(ptepage));
- }
- #define pmd_populate_kernel(MM, PMD, PTE) pmd_set(PMD, PTE)
- #define pmd_populate(MM,PMD,PTE_PAGE) \
- pmd_populate_kernel(MM,PMD,page_address(PTE_PAGE))
- #define check_pgt_cache() do { } while (0)
- #endif /* _SPARC64_PGALLOC_H */
